News From Argentina
The Argentine Toxicological Association (ATA) is the oldest scientific
entity that joins all the toxicologists of Argentina since 1975. Among
other activities, ATA organizes each year both the Argentinean Congress
of Toxicology and the Interdisciplinary Meeting of Toxicology that join
all the toxicologists.
It also publishes a quarterly Bulletin ATA Informa that is edited and distributed
on line among all members, as well as the scientific Journal Acta Toxicológica
Argentina, of which 8 volumes have already been published; it is indexed
by the Chemical Abstracts.
ATA is preparing the edition of a book titled ADVANCES OF THE TOXICOLOGY
IN ARGENTINA; Dr. Nelson Albiano and Dr. Alfredo Salibián, both
former Presidents of the ATA have been appointed to act as Editors.
The book will present a collection of original articles written by most
of the outstanding Argentinean toxicologists who will expose their experience
as well as their more significant contributions developed in their laboratories
and Institutes.
The book will be interdisciplinary and will cover most of the areas of
the Toxicology. Approximately 30 papers have already been selected, covering
topics of the Veterinary, Forensic, Environmental, Clinical and Ecological
Toxicology. Other articles will devoted to basic Toxicology as Neurotoxicology,
resistance mechanism and effects of insecticides on non target species,
animal toxins, etc.
It is timely to point out that the book of the ATA will be the first interdisciplinary
toxicological text edited and published in Latin America, presenting the
results of original research entirely conducted in local laboratories.
